Stroll down Han Tou Road to experience Xiamen's most authentic local vibe! This lively old street hides time-honored snack stalls, traditional tea shops and handicraft stores, where Minnan red-brick architecture blends with hipster boutiques. Come at dusk when lanterns glow – the whole street transforms into a retro photography paradise. Don't miss sizzling Wu Xiang Rolls and sea worm jelly, they're Xiamen's ultimate street food icons!
